Join us for a screening of In A Different Key. This PBS documentary follows a mother tracking down the first person ever diagnosed with autism in a rural Mississippi town.
Please note, this comprehensive look at the history of autism and the challenges faced is rated TV-14; it contains sensitive content and some violence. A discussion panel to follow directly after the movie, in collaboration with the Reading Public Library, Reading Public Schools, Reading SEPAC, and the Reading Office of Equity and Social Justice.
